Output ef3c69c4c26528f40759fff87b90246f962c2fc5aaf77208430cea2cdf4b4aa0:0

value
70119
script pubkey
OP_0 OP_PUSHBYTES_20 01f66eb59154e9752a5f83cf9d8f3bac6539e0d3
address
tb1qq8mxadv32n5h22jls08emrem43jnncxnlqd55e
transaction
ef3c69c4c26528f40759fff87b90246f962c2fc5aaf77208430cea2cdf4b4aa0